Physical characteristics
· Around 6.5- 12.8ft
· Sleek, smooth, rubbery skin
· Pectoral flippers (breast/chest) are slightly curved back and pointed at the tips
· From the tip of each fluke (lobe of the dolphin’s tale) to the next measures 23.4in.
· Has 18-26 teeth on each side of the upper jaw leaving a total of 72-104 teeth which are designed to grasp and are never replaced.
· Their dorsal fin is found at the center of their backs. Its shape varies from different sizes. It contains no bones, no cartilage or muscle.
· The melon which is the rounded region of a dolphin’s forehead contains fat and it pays an important role in the dolphin’s echolocation
· Eyes are on the sides of their heads and close to their mouth
